diff --git a/.gitea/workflows/build.yml b/.gitea/workflows/build.yml index bc9346e..c6263ee 100644 --- a/.gitea/workflows/build.yml +++ b/.gitea/workflows/build.yml @@ -104,16 +104,22 @@ jobs: # 构建并上传镜像 TODO 直接用docker命令操作 - name: Build and push Docker image - uses: http://139.9.216.111:3000/bamanker/build-push-action@v4 # 获取上一步截取到的版本号,既 1.0.0 +# uses: http://139.9.216.111:3000/bamanker/build-push-action@v4 # 获取上一步截取到的版本号,既 1.0.0 #只能这样接收 env: TAG: ${{ steps.set_envar.outputs.tag }} - with: - context: . -# platforms: linux/amd64 - file: Dockerfile - push: true - tags: ${{ env.REGISTRY }}/${{ env.IMAGE_NAMESPACE }}/${{ env.IMAGE_NAME }}:${{ env.TAG }} + run: | + docker buildx build \ + --platform linux/amd64 \ + --tag ${{ env.REGISTRY }}/${{ env.IMAGE_NAMESPACE }}/${{ env.IMAGE_NAME }}:${{ env.TAG }} \ + --push \ + . +# with: +# context: . +## platforms: linux/amd64 +# file: Dockerfile +# push: true +# tags: ${{ env.REGISTRY }}/${{ env.IMAGE_NAMESPACE }}/${{ env.IMAGE_NAME }}:${{ env.TAG }} #发布到 k8s - name: Generate kubeconfig